Understanding Door Hinges

What Are Door Hinges?

Door hinges are mechanical devices that link two things, enabling them to pivot relative to each other. For doors, hinges work as the pivot point, enabling them to open and close seamlessly.

Types of Door Hinges

To much better comprehend the significance of door hinges, let's take a more detailed take a look at the various types that can be discovered in homes:

Type of Hinge

Description

Common Uses

Butt Hinge

The most common kind of hinge, including two rectangular leaves.

Used for most interior and exterior doors.

Piano Hinge

A long hinge that runs the whole length of a door.

Perfect for folding doors and piano lids.

Continuous Hinge

Comparable to a piano hinge, providing additional support and stability.

Heavy doors and commercial applications.

Hidden Hinge

Concealed from view when the door is closed, providing a tidy aesthetic.

Modern cabinets and high-end furnishings.

Spring Hinge

Automatically closes the door after opening, using a spring system.

Perfect for doors that need automated closure.

Strap Hinge

Functions long leaves that extend along the door.

Typically utilized for gates and shed doors.

Pivot Hinge

Permits a door to pivot from a single point at the top and bottom.

Frequently discovered in commercial or sturdy doors.

Common Issues with Door Hinges

While door hinges are developed to sustain daily wear and tear, they can still come across numerous typical concerns:

  • Squeaking Noises: Often an indication of lack of lubrication.
  • Misalignment: Doors that do not close properly might suggest that hinges run out alignment.
  • Rust and Corrosion: Especially in outside doors, rust can deteriorate the hinges with time.
  • Fractures or Breaks: Heavy doors and regular use can cause hinges to crack or break.
  • Difficulty Opening/Closing: Loose screws or damaged parts can result in difficulty in operation.

Acknowledging these issues early can conserve considerable time and money on repairs.
